CVS same store sales up 6.2 percent

CVS Caremark Corp. said same-store sales for the four weeks ended May 26 in its CVS Pharmacy division increased by 6.2 percent over the same period the previous year.

The company said pharmacy same store sales increased 6 percent, “and were negatively impacted by approximately 590 basis points due to recent generic introductions.”

Front-end same store sales increased 6.6 percent, the company said.

During the same period, the company opened 15 new stores, closed five stores, and relocated five others. The company operates 6,168 stores in 40 states.

The company, which is based in Woonsocket, R.I., said it did not include drug stores acquired in June 2006 in the same-store results.
